
Three persons have been arrested at the Katunayake International Airport for attempting to smuggle foreign currency worth over Rs 20 million out of the country, a customs official said.
The suspects had arrived at the airport this morning in order to board a flight to Singapore when they were searched based on a suspicion, customs spokesman Leslie Gamini said.
Undeclared foreign currency, including Euros and Swiss francs, estimated to be worth over Rs 20 million were found in the possession of the suspects, who were attempting to smuggle the currency out of the country by concealing them in their rectal cavities.
The arrested men are residents of Jaffna, Negombo and Matale while airport customs are conducting further investigations.
